Welcome to the Santa Barbara County Alcohol Program (SBADP) home page, a division of Santa Barbara County Alcohol, and Mental Health Services (ADMHS).
SBADP's role is to provide treatment services for those in need of alcohol reatment, dual diagnosis, sober living, detoxification, perinatal services, as well as provide services to Prop 36 and Drinking Driver clients. Our unique Youth & Family Treatment Centers, which are strategically located in Lompoc, Santa Barbara and Santa Maria, provide services to youth and their families in need of alcohol treatment and counseling services for families. Most of our contracted treatment services provide sliding scale fees for service and accept Medical.
Our prevention services include Mentoring, Youth Leadership, Friday Night Live, Substance Abuse Prevention Coalitions, and School-based Counseling services throughout the County. And, we also provide technical assistance to local neighborhoods and communities to respond to alcohol problems.
